Frankenstein: How To Make A Monster is at Contact Manchester May 10–14, a gig-theatre production by Battersea Arts Centre and BAC Beatbox Academy, inspired by the original monstrous tale.

Six performers with six microphones take apart Mary Shelley’s original and reimagine a world of modern monsters.

Using their mouths to make every sound, they challenge how today’s society creates its own monsters.

Running Time: 80 mins (no interval). Recommended for ages 14+.
